Game Overview

The goal of this project is to provide people with a relaxing space away from the overloaded tasks, technologies, and deadlines. In this virtual reality natural environment, you will find yourself immersed in this personal space and time spent with just yourself. This project is created with Unity, and players would have to use Unity to run the program. This current version only supports Oculus Quest.

features

In this virtual reality environment, player will be able to listen to the sound of a real forest and explore the space. It is a good place for meditation if your looking for a personal space away from disruptions. Or if you’re just looking for a place to have fun in, you can use the bow and arrow in your hands to shoot around.

Developer’s words

This project was initially intended to be completed with TiltBrush and AnimVR. However, now that we’re all locked under quarantine, I do not have access to any VR equipment, but life must go on, this project needs to be completed. Then I chose to use Unity which is completely new to me. I had to learn a lot of things from the beginning, but I was glad that it all worked out.
